Driver Arrested for Faking Robbery to Embezzle ₹1.09 Lakh, Entire Amount Recovered

Kaithal, March – The CIA-1 police have arrested a driver who falsely reported a robbery to misappropriate ₹1.09 lakh. According to the police spokesperson, Mahabir Singh, a resident of Dhanouri village, filed a complaint stating that his village-based oilcake mill had a pickup truck rented for transportation. The truck had been driven by Dharmbir for the past six months, delivering oilcake to different districts.

On March 27, Dharmbir loaded the truck with oilcake and transported it to Ambala. While returning, he was carrying ₹1.09 lakh belonging to the mill. Around noon, he called the mill manager, Deepak, and reported that two unidentified men stopped his vehicle near the Kaithal Water Park, threw chili powder in his eyes, and snatched the cash. However, investigations later revealed that the driver had fabricated the story to keep the money for himself.

Following SP Rajesh Kalia’s orders, a team led by CIA-1 in-charge SI Paras and ASI Sanjay Kumar arrested Dharmbir, a resident of Dhanouri village. During interrogation, the accused confessed to staging the fake robbery to embezzle the money. The entire sum of ₹1.09 lakh was recovered from his possession. On Saturday, the court remanded him to judicial custody.
